Output ad9b3b4cb23365fb667a098038dcba8b3e28de1a91edb9ef26660366d26d360f:14

value
587794061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5206039cf81ebe80df441fa4424cd47c59cff459 OP_EQUAL
address
39AiY9BJBVG3okAcy4bQnmbHmtgU3rSMDZ
transaction
ad9b3b4cb23365fb667a098038dcba8b3e28de1a91edb9ef26660366d26d360f
confirmations
310537
spent
true